Member Feature: Brian Bakken

Share a fun personal fact:
During a one-month trip, I have traveled around the world (literally).
(US->Shanghai->Singapore->Denmark->Iceland->US)
How long have you been a SIM member?
I joined SIM in 2006
Why do you invest your time in SIM?
During the years I have been a SIM member I have made numerous friendships with colleagues who have also provided me great information and advice. Most of the various speakers we have had at the events have been educational and thought provoking.
What is one of the most important lessons you’ve learned in your career?
Never stop learning. The advice I have also given to many people is that you can learn from all situations and people your career brings you into contact with.
Tell us about an impactful SIM event that you’ve attended, and what you took away from it.
There isn’t a single event I could call out as more impactful than others. What I find valuable with the SIM events is the variety of topics and speakers there have been. Most events have provided me with insights and ideas that I can reflect on and consider what they would mean within my role and career.
What is one goal you have for 2021?
I started with Loram Nov 2020 so one goal I have is to establish myself and start to evolve the IT team and the company into a global setting.
How will we remember you?
I believe I will be remembered by being a calm person that has a lot of insight to offer.
